Central States Thermo King expands back east

Mega transport-refrigeration dealer Central States Thermo King Inc. (CSTK) has acquired the assets of Thermo King of Philadelphia, Philadelphia, PA; Thermo King of Lehigh Valley, Allentown, PA; Thermo King of Scranton, Jessup, PA; and Thermo King of Vineland, Vineland, NJ. The four dealerships will be reorganized and re-designated as CSTK East.

Kansas City, KS-based CSTK and its sister company, Velociti Inc., which specializes in deploying wireless technology, currently have locations in St. Louis, MO; Oklahoma City, OK; Wichita, KS; Barstow, CA; and Atlanta, GA, as well as corporate headquarters and other operating divisions in Kansas City.

In addition to the sale and service of equipment manufactured by Thermo King Corporation, CSTK provides a variety of transportation solutions, including idle-reduction systems, telematics, truck and trailer replacement parts and repair services, guaranteed maintenance contracts and snow removal equipment. Most of these products and services will be offered by CSTK East before the end of the second quarter of 2006, said CSTK.

"In response to changing customer's demands, our Midwest operations have added a myriad of products and services to our Thermo King line to permit us to provide a one-stop shop for our customer's transportation needs," stated Michael Kahn, president & CEO for CSTK and general counsel of Velociti. "Our customers like this concept and have asked us to expand to other regions. We intend to provide current CSTK customers with operations in the East and our new customers with the expanded services and products that CSTK customers expect and the customer service they rightly demand."
